# Seat-map renderer for the Velda Hall booking flow. The renderer
# tiles the auditorium into zones and draws each zone on its own
# canvas layer, refreshing only layers whose availability changed
# since the last snapshot. If the refresh queue backs up, the UI
# falls back to a full redraw, which is expensive on large venues
# and the usual cause of pager alerts during on-sale spikes. Before
# touching anything mid-incident, check the queue depth metric
# first. The tuning constants are as follows.

tuning table, hafog-bahaf:
QUOTAS = {
    "praion": 144,
    "briax": 906,
    "silwyn": 451,
}

Handover note — Crumbwheel order cutoffs.

Welcome aboard. The bakery cutoff rule in Crumbwheel closes same-day orders at 14:00 local to each storefront, not UTC — this has bitten us twice. Holiday overrides live in the calendar service and take precedence silently, so always check there first when a cutoff looks wrong. To unlock the calendar service's admin console after a restart, enter the recovery passphrase below.

vault phrase of bagap-bahaf = silion-pelox-sorox-casdor-quenwyn-fraax-eliox-praael-kelion-quenvan-kasox-rusael-norius-belvan

// Nightly search reindex for the Marlowe catalog runs against this
// shard count. New team members: do not lower it casually — the
// Drayville cluster sizes its worker pool from this constant, and a
// mismatch means partial indexes at dawn. Changes require a full
// rebuild, validated against the reference build recorded below.

build token for tahop-fafof: htk14_2d55df8101eccc

**Action item (P2):** The Lanternkit component library shipped three breaking changes under patch versions last quarter, which is how the checkout team ended up pinned to a fork. Going forward, any prop removal or rename bumps the major version, no exceptions. We've drafted a versioning policy plus a migration checklist for consumers. The full policy lives on our internal wiki page.

runbook for tajep-yahig: https://artifactory.lumictech.corp/repo